Defence Digital Commercial (DDCmrcl) is the core team responsible for delivering outstanding value for Defence across its exploitation of digital and information technologies. We are responsible for a large portfolio of complex contracts worth £2bn a year. We operate across five category teams:

Networks The Networks Category sources and manages contracts which provide fixed data and voice capabilities, together with mobile and radio services managed by Defence Digital for services across Defence.

IT Hardware & Services The Hardware & Services category procures the supply and management of the MOD’s enterprise IT in both fixed (UK and overseas) and deployed environments, high grade messaging and medium and high threat gateways.

Military Technology The Military Technology Category procures a diverse range of Digital Defence equipment such as Military Satellites, Battlefield & Tactical Communication & Information Systems and nuclear response warning systems.

Software & Cloud - supports Defence Digital through, Cloud and Hosting Services, Digital Foundry Artificial Intelligence Centre, Mission Information Exploitation, Pan MOD Software Enterprise Agreements, Cyber and Crypt Key.

Professional Services Procures all external resource requirements across Defence Digital. From Strategy Consultancy to Individual contractors including staff augmentation and all delivery support.

The Cyber Commercial team support the MoD’s Cyber Programmes (Defensive Cyber Operations, Cyber Resilience Programme and Digital Identity for Defence) as well as wider Cyber activities, which all substantially reduce MoD’s Cyber risk, protect critical asset and systems, and develop a cyber aware workforce that will allow MoD to make cyber security part of the DNA of its business and operations. The Ministry of Defence is committed to providing a safe and healthy working environment for its staff which includes educating them on the benefits of not smoking, protecting them from the harmful effects of second-hand smoke and supporting those who want to give up smoking. Under the Smoke-Free Working Environment policy, Smoking and the use of all tobacco products (including combustible and chewing tobacco products) will not be permitted anywhere in the Defence working environment by 31st December 2022. The policy is Whole Force and includes all Defence personnel, contractors, visitors and other non-MOD personnel. All applicants seeking, considering, or accepting employment with the Ministry of Defence should be aware of this policy and that it is already in place at a number of Defence Establishments.
